In English, we'd be more likely to use the present progressive tense, the "you are using" or "t ests usando" one. In Spanish, its pretty common to use what wed call the simple present, or just the present tense, moreso than it is in English. Its generally used in situations when you really want to emphasize that this is what youre doing right now, maybe in contrast to what you were doing five minutes ago or what you plan to do tomorrow.
